Will I prescribe medications if they are needed?

No. We are not medical doctors and as such we do not have prescription privileges. We can, however, refer you to an appropriate medical practitioner who can assess whether you need any medication.

What if other members of my family won’t participate?

It isn't necessary for your spouse or other family members to attend therapy sessions with you. You will still benefit from the sessions. Often later on, after your family see the changes the therapy has brought about in you, they may also feel like attending. But of course we will do everything possible to help all members participate, so that the whole family can change, not just you.

How long do sessions last?

Sessions average a bit less than an hour, but they can sometimes be shorter or longer depending on your needs. We do extended sessions to help move things along or when there is much work that needs to get done.
